李耀芳 %J 计算机系统应用 %D 2010 %I %X Data mining methods are applied to the system to extract data for analysis of Chinese medicine and forecasting. First, the data integration and discrete treatment are made, to obtain appropriate data mining data sets. Then k-means and DBSCAN clustering algorithm are used to cluster the data quality control. Quality control process parameters interval are obtained. Apriori algorithm is improved by adding a user interest degree in the concept. The candidate set of exponential growth is controlled. The relationship between parameters and solids is got. By using three-layer BP neural network algorithm trained network model, the relationship between the process parameters and results quality parameters is obtained. The law implied in the data is found. It provides a scientific analysis and decision support for enterprises to optimize processes and improve their productivity and reduce the costs. %K mining analysis %K Chinese medicine production %K clustering %K association rules %K neural network
